How to fill out unified carrier registration

How to fill out Unified Carrier Registration
01
Gather necessary information: Collect your business details including your USDOT number, legal business name, and contact information.
02
Determine your registration type: Identify if you are a carrier, broker, or freight forwarder as requirements may vary.
03
Visit the Unified Carrier Registration (UCR) website: Go to the official UCR website to access the registration form.
04
Fill out the registration form: Input all required data accurately according to the instructions provided.
05
Choose payment method: Select your method of payment for the registration fees, which vary based on the number of vehicles you operate.
06
Submit your registration: Review all entries for accuracy, then submit your application electronically if the option is available.
07
Receive confirmation: After submission, look for a confirmation email or message indicating your registration status.
Who needs Unified Carrier Registration?
01
Motor carriers that operate commercial vehicles in interstate or international commerce.
02
Freight brokers who facilitate transportation services.
03
Freight forwarders involved in the shipping process from origin to destination.

What vehicles need to be registered for UCR?
Who needs a UCR filing? Any motor carrier who drives a commercial vehicle carrying cargo over state or international lines needs to file a UCR. Individuals and companies who make arrangements for the shipment of goods, such as brokers, freight forwarders, and leasing companies are also subject to the UCR fee.
Is unified carrier registration mandatory?
You ARE REQUIRED to register with UCR.
Who is exempt from UCR fees?
Congress has granted exemptions from UCR for farm vehicles that are not for hire and are regulated by a state that has in effect an intrastate motor carrier regulation with the UCR Plan. Who is subject to UCR? If you have commercial vehicles that operate in interstate (across state lines) commerce, over 10,000 pounds, regardless of the type of vehicle registration or type of operation, you are required to have a USDOT number. You are also subject to the Unified Carrier Registration (UCR) program.
Who is required to have an UCR?
What is Unified Carrier Registration? The UCR is a state revenue-sharing program and interstate compact established by federal law in 2005 that requires all operators of commercial vehicles who are involved in interstate and international travel to register and pay annual fees.

What is Unified Carrier Registration?
Unified Carrier Registration (UCR) is a state-administered program that requires certain motor carriers, brokers, and freight forwarders to register and pay an annual fee based on their vehicle fleet size.
Who is required to file Unified Carrier Registration?
Motor carriers, freight forwarders, brokers, and leasing companies that operate commercial vehicles in interstate or international commerce are required to file Unified Carrier Registration.
How to fill out Unified Carrier Registration?
To fill out Unified Carrier Registration, visit the UCR website, complete the online registration form by providing necessary information such as business details and vehicle counts, and submit the form along with the appropriate fees.
What is the purpose of Unified Carrier Registration?
The purpose of Unified Carrier Registration is to provide a system for registering and collecting fees from interstate carriers, ensuring they comply with federal regulations. The funds collected support state highway safety programs.
What information must be reported on Unified Carrier Registration?
The information that must be reported includes the number of commercial vehicles operated, fleet composition, the name and address of the motor carrier, and payment details for annual fees based on the number of vehicles.
